1. Components and Their Maintenance Needs
A Light Guide Plate Laminating Machine is composed of several key components, each with its own maintenance requirements. The laminating rollers are at the heart of the machine. These rollers are responsible for applying pressure evenly during the lamination process. Over time, the surface of the rollers can wear out due to constant contact with the light guide plates and laminating materials. Regular cleaning is essential to prevent the build - up of debris and adhesive residues. Depending on the usage intensity, roller replacement may be necessary every 1 - 3 years. The cost of a new set of high - quality laminating rollers can range from $500 to $2000, depending on the size and material of the rollers.
The heating system is another critical component. It ensures that the laminating film adheres properly to the light guide plate. Maintenance of the heating system includes checking the heating elements for any signs of damage or uneven heating. A malfunctioning heating element can lead to poor lamination quality. The cost of replacing a heating element can vary from $200 to $800, depending on the complexity of the system.
The control panel, which manages the machine's operations such as temperature, pressure, and speed settings, also requires regular inspection. Software updates may be needed to ensure the machine operates efficiently. In some cases, electrical components on the control panel may fail and need replacement. The cost of repairing or replacing control panel components can be anywhere from $300 to $1500, depending on the extent of the damage.
2. Preventive Maintenance Costs
Preventive maintenance is a proactive approach that helps reduce the likelihood of major breakdowns and extends the lifespan of the Light Guide Plate Laminating Machine. Regular preventive maintenance tasks include lubricating moving parts, tightening loose bolts, and inspecting electrical connections.
The cost of lubricants and other maintenance supplies can add up over time. A year's supply of high - quality lubricants for the machine's moving parts may cost around $100 - $300. Additionally, conducting regular preventive maintenance inspections by a professional technician can cost approximately $500 - $1000 per year, depending on the complexity of the machine and the region where the service is provided.
3. Unplanned Maintenance Costs
Despite the best preventive maintenance efforts, unplanned breakdowns can still occur. These breakdowns can be caused by a variety of factors, such as sudden power surges, mechanical failures, or operator errors.


When an unplanned breakdown occurs, the cost of repair can be significant. In addition to the cost of replacement parts, there is also the cost of labor for the technician to diagnose and fix the problem. Labor costs for machine repair can range from $80 to $150 per hour, depending on the technician's experience and the location.
For example, if a major mechanical failure occurs in the conveyor system of the laminating machine, the cost of replacing damaged conveyor belts and associated parts, along with labor costs, could be upwards of $2000.

5. Factors Affecting Maintenance Cost
Several factors can affect the maintenance cost of a Light Guide Plate Laminating Machine. The frequency of use is a major factor. Machines that are used continuously for long hours every day will experience more wear and tear compared to those used intermittently. As a result, the maintenance cost for a high - usage machine will be higher.
The quality of the machine also plays a role. Higher - quality machines are generally built with better - quality components and more advanced manufacturing techniques. They may have a higher upfront cost but often require less maintenance in the long run.
The environment in which the machine operates is another important factor. A dirty or dusty environment can cause more rapid wear of the machine's components, leading to increased maintenance costs. On the other hand, a clean and well - regulated environment can help reduce maintenance needs.
6. Strategies to Reduce Maintenance Cost
To reduce the maintenance cost of a Light Guide Plate Laminating Machine, businesses can implement several strategies. First, proper operator training is essential. Well - trained operators are less likely to make errors that could lead to machine damage. They can also perform basic maintenance tasks such as cleaning and lubrication correctly.
Second, establishing a detailed maintenance schedule and sticking to it can prevent minor issues from turning into major problems. Regularly scheduled inspections and preventive maintenance tasks can catch potential issues early and save on repair costs.
Finally, partnering with a reliable maintenance service provider can be beneficial. These providers often have access to discounted parts and can offer more cost - effective maintenance solutions.
